Additives, Preservatives and Fillers

In our society over the last few years it seems that there has been some sort of a Health Food Craze, and for good reason. With all the diseases that seem to be appearing, and with everyone knowing at least one person who has cancer, it seems there are more discoveries of these cancers being linked to chemicals that have been added to the foods that we eat.

Additives, Preservatives and Fillers, three forms of chemicals that are added to our foods for multiple purposes, that for the most part, we don’t even realize could be harmful to us.

Additives are added to foods to preserve flavour or improve its taste and appearance. As stated by Health Canada, any chemical substance that is added to food during preparation or storage and either becomes a part of the food or affects its characteristics, for the purpose of achieving a particular technical affect, is considered an additive.

``Preservatives can be natural or synthetic substances, chemicals that are added to food to prevent decomposition by microbial growth or by undesired chemical changes, as well, to avoid spoilage during transportation time.``(http://www.foodadditivesworld.com/preservatives.html)

``Fillers are additives that help bulk up the weight of food with less expensive ingredients which helps keep the price down. `` (http://recipes.howstuffworks.com/food-fillers-101.htm)

``Some of the immediate effects of chemicals and additives in your food may cause headaches or alter your energy level, or they may affect your mental concentration, behaviour, or immune response. Those with long-term effects could increase your risk of cancer, cardiovascular disease and other degenerative conditions. Avoiding additives in your diet is an important step toward enhancing your health and lowering your risk of disease. `` Says Eve V. Allen, Ph.D., N.D.c in her article ``How Food Additives Affect our Health. ``

Some of the worst food additives include: Aspartame –which may cause brain damage in phenylketonurics; may cause central nervous system disturbances, menstrual difficulties; may affect brain development in an unborn fetus. As well as; Hydrogenated Vegetable Oils - associated with heart disease, breast and colon cancer, atherosclerosis, elevated cholesterol.
